The perimeter of a figure is the sum of its side lengths.

The perimeter of the figure is 16.5 cm

From the given figure, we have the side lengths to be:

Lengths: 1.1 cm, 4.8 cm, 2 cm, 5 cm and 3.6 cm

So, the perimeter is:

[tex]\mathbf{Perimeter = 1.1cm + 4.8cm + 2cm + 5cm + 3.6cm}[/tex]

Add the lengths

[tex]\mathbf{Perimeter = 16.5cm}[/tex]

Hence, the perimeter of the figure is 16.5 cm
